Early day motion · EDM 2823 · 6 Mar 2012
GENENTECH AND THE USE OF LUCENTIS AND AVASTIN FOR OPHTHALMIC PURPOSES
Tabled by John Hemming (Liberal Democrat)
3 signatures
The motion
That this House notes the positive clinical results from the use of Lucentis for ophthalmic uses; further notes that Avastin has also been found to be efficacious for similar purposes; further notes that Genentech, the manufacturer of both, has resisted the clinical use of Avastin in an ophthalmic setting; queries whether the fact that Lucentis has a cost of the order of 40 times the cost of Avastin is a matter which is influencing the manufacturer; and calls on Health Ministers to enter into discussions with Genentech as to how most effectively patients in England can have their ophthalmic issues properly medicated.
